Transaction 31dd7880d8dfc568421f97bd547ef39b09b1ebbe0a9bfba3b327476471757908

1 Input
2 Outputs
  • 31dd7880d8dfc568421f97bd547ef39b09b1ebbe0a9bfba3b327476471757908:0
  • value  2088331
    address  1K6ThhrPVV1zMYkgfDYnTSz2NNzoV3Fh28
  • 31dd7880d8dfc568421f97bd547ef39b09b1ebbe0a9bfba3b327476471757908:1
  • value  412529572
    address  3QMAh5WjK36SUUHEweE2sdE3eQyDg7BCor